PEACH Conferences
PEACH has already held 3 major conferences including:
- 'An Introduction to Lovaas/ABA' in 1997 attended by Dr Ivar Lovaas and his wife Dr Nina Lovaas.
- 'Putting Research Into Practice' in 1999 attended by Dr Glenn Sallows and Dr Svein Eikeseth
|
|
- 'ABA, An introduction' in April 2000 held in Stirling, Scotland.
- The 4th PEACH Conference attended by Dr Bridget Taylor and Dr Anne Maxwell, which was 'An Introduction to ABA'.
- Peach conference 2002 held in October in Birmingham was titled 'ABA in the UK - Looking to the Future'.
- In 2003 the conference was held in Reading in October the theme was 'Moving On' - and addressed the issues which arise when children with autism transfer from primary to secondary school.
